Indiana 4A State Championship Game - Wish us well......

on Saturday, November 28th. Kickoff is at 2:30 Central time at Lucas Oil Stadium (Home of the Colts)

My team is the Lowell Red Devils (my Alma mater) and we face the ESPN #48 ranked Evansville Reitz Panthers. This will be hard game to win but our boys play with a lot of heart and an incredible amount of intensity. We have been underdogs most of the post season but they have put together some impressive wins over quality opponents along the way.

Evansville is 14-0 and Lowell is 13-1. This will be Lowell's 3rd state final game in the past 5 years. An impressive accomplishment for a program that used to be everybody's doormat back during my high school years. The program has turned around completely, from a perrenial doormat to a perrenial 4A power within the past 20 years and things look quite promising in the years to come.

Like I mentioned before, we are an underdog in this game but you know what they say about the big boys, When they fall, they fall hard!! So, wish us well......

How does California do it?
Horribly but it's better then the plain voting they used to have just a few years ago. The state title bowls are broken down into divisions 1-3 and there's also a "open" state title game between the top ranked team from northern Cali and southern Cali. So technically there's 4 state titles played for but the actual playoffs go only as far a section titles in divisions 1-5. It sucks for the top teams in Central California that don't have the recognition power that the teams from the Southern Section/LA get. They get lumped into the Southern Section which it packed full of teams, IMO Central Section teams should be at least considered Northern California just cause the number of teams aren't nearly as high as the Southern Section.
